Have you ever wondered how to use all those piping nozzles you have lying around at home? Join Bake with Carli for her online slice decorating workshop and learn how to create cute designs on your baked goods!

Perfect for beginners, this short online workshop is great for anyone looking to dip their toes into the wonderful world of buttercream decorating. After completing this class you can unleash your creative side to make unique designs from scratch.

This class will cover:

  • How to make buttercream, including colouring and flavouring
  • How to fill a piping bag easily with no mess
  • Learn to pipe basic rosettes, stars and more with a variety of nozzles.

You will come away with a whole bundle of knowledge about creating different designs. Begin your buttercream decorating journey with confidence at this fun online workshop!

Hi I'm Carli and I'm a cake teacher.

I grew up in Perth, in a house where my mum made delicious treats every weekend from scratch.

I’m talking vanilla slice, chocolate eclairs, fairy cakes, cinnamon scrolls. Really, I could go on.

I got diagnosed with a nut allergy at 19, and it kind of flipped my dessert world upside down. I knew I would have to learn to bake for myself to enjoy safe treats and satisfy that sweet tooth.

My dream became a reality when I studied at TAFE and ran a successful home baking business for many years, baking safe treats for all occasions. I then discovered a love of teaching. I’d once planned to study a dip Ed and go into teaching so I guess it makes sense, but wowee, do I get a buzz out of it!

I have a passion for food and I LOVE sharing my baking tips with others so they too can create delicious memories with loved ones. I’m not sure there’s anything better than sitting down and savouring some home-baked treats, so I want to pass that on to as many people as I can.

I am also about making baking easy and fitting in around your life/health/kids. Baking doesn’t need to be overly complicated or mean needing more tools that you know what to do with. I’m all about simplicity.
